The Evolution of Curvy Black Fashion

Black fashion history has long centered on the dignity and power of the silhouette. Pioneering Designers: Figures like Zelda Wynn Valdes

were instrumental in the mid-20th century for creating form-fitting "freakum dresses" specifically tailored to curvy Black icons like Dorothy Dandridge and Ella Fitzgerald.

Cultural Shifts: From the "Sunday's Best" of the Civil Rights movement to the bold, skin-baring styles of the 70s disco era and the baggy, street-style aesthetic of 90s hip-hop, Black women have consistently used fashion to express self-acceptance and protest against rigid beauty norms. The phrase "fotos negras culonas y tetonas desnudas repack" refers to a specific type of digital content often found in adult entertainment circles. This term describes a curated collection of explicit images featuring Black women, typically organized by physical attributes and distributed as a "repack"—a compressed file or bundle intended for easy downloading and sharing. Analyzing this phenomenon requires looking at the intersection of digital consumption, the objectification of Black bodies, and the legal and ethical implications of non-consensual content distribution.

Historically, the portrayal of Black women’s bodies has been shaped by a legacy of hypersexualization. In the context of adult media, this often manifests as "fetishization," where specific physical traits are emphasized to cater to a particular niche. The use of terms like "culona" and "tetona" highlights this focus on physical exaggeration. While the adult industry is a legitimate sector of the global economy, the way content is categorized and marketed can reinforce reductive stereotypes, stripping individuals of their personhood and reducing them to a set of physical characteristics.

The "repack" element of the phrase introduces a different set of concerns, primarily related to digital ethics and consent. In the digital age, a repack is often a collection of content that has been scraped from various sources—such as social media, subscription-based platforms like OnlyFans, or private leaks—and bundled together for free distribution on forums or torrent sites. This practice frequently occurs without the permission of the creators or the subjects in the photos. This raises significant issues regarding "revenge porn" and the violation of digital privacy. When content is redistributed in this manner, the subjects lose control over their image, which can have devastating personal and professional consequences.

Furthermore, the "repack" culture often thrives in the "gray market" of the internet, where copyright infringement is rampant. For creators who make a living through adult modeling, these unauthorized bundles represent a direct loss of income. From a legal standpoint, downloading or hosting such content can expose users to malware or legal action depending on the jurisdiction and the specific nature of the material included in the bundle.

In conclusion, while the search term might appear to be a simple request for adult media, it sits at the heart of complex social and legal issues. It reflects a long-standing history of hypersexualizing Black women and highlights the modern challenges of maintaining consent and privacy in a digital landscape. Understanding the implications of "repacked" content is essential for a broader conversation about digital ethics, the protection of creators, and the importance of consensual consumption in the 21st century.
